当前位置: 首页 » 产品 » 电子五金 » 正文

linux中vsftpd 530 Login incorrect 解决

放大字体  缩小字体 发布日期: 2024-10-20 07:55   来源:http://www.baidu.com/  作者:无忧资讯  浏览次数:9
核心提示:  vsftpd 530 Login incorrect这个问题很常见,网上一搜很多,但是绝大部分,都是忽悠人的。下面说一下我的解决办法,  服务

  vsftpd 530 Login incorrect这个问题很常见,网上一搜很多,但是绝大部分,都是忽悠人的。下面说一下我的解决办法,

  服务器说明:服务器用的是centos 6.5 64 位,vsftpd用的是vsftpd: version 2.2.2,系统用户是nologin的

  1, 检查/etc/vsftpd/vsftpd.conf配置

 代码如下      


local_enable=YES  
pam_service_name=vsftpd     //有人说ubuntu是pam_service_name=ftp(本人未测试)  
userlist_enable=YES 

 

  2,修改/etc/vsftpd/ftpusers

 代码如下      
# vim /etc/pam.d/vsftpd   //你会发现,拒绝ftpusers里面的用户  
auth       required     pam_listfile.so item=user sense=deny file=http://www.3lian.com/etc/vsftpd/ftpusers onerr=succeed  
 

  ftpusers里面是ftp默认拒绝的用户,如果要想系统用户,就把这个用户从ftpusers文件中删除。

 代码如下      

[root@node1 vsftpd]# cat /etc/vsftpd/ftpusers  
# Users that are not allowed to login via ftp  
root  
bin  
#daemon   //删除掉就能登录了  
adm  
lp  
sync  
 

  。。。。。。。。。省略。。。。。。。。。

  在这里要注意,不要把/etc/pam.d/vsftpd里面的deny改成allow,不然你自己建立的用户就会报530 Login incorrect

  3,重启vsftpd

 代码如下      
# /etc/init.d/vsftpd start   

 
 
[ 产品搜索 ]  [ 加入收藏 ]  [ 告诉好友 ]  [ 打印本文 ]  [ 违规举报 ]  [ 关闭窗口 ]

 

 
推荐图文
推荐产品
点击排行
    行业协会  备案信息  可信网站